Echocardiography, or Echo, uses ultrasound to show the structure, valves, chambers, and pumping function of the heart in real time.
Echo evaluates how strongly the heart pumps and whether the chambers are enlarged.
It shows valve narrowing, leakage, structural defects, and fluid around the heart.
The test helps detect heart failure, cardiomyopathy, and many long-term heart conditions.
Because it is non-invasive, it is widely used for diagnosis as well as follow-up monitoring.
